The Senate finally confirmed Thomas Curry as the new Comptroller of the Currency, head of the Office of the Comptroller of the Currency. It will be interesting to see if the OCC swings more to protecting consumers than banks under Curry's leadership. In addition, the Senate confirmed FTC chair Jon Leibowitz for a second term (the confirmation is as an FTC commissioner, not the FTC chair; the president designates the chair from among the commissioners) and Maureen Ohlhausen as an FTC commissioner.
